Why Surface Cleaning Without Treatment Fails in Tompkinsville

A cleaning that physically removes the visible mold colony without applying antimicrobial treatment leaves residual spores and hyphae on the duct surfaces in Tompkinsville, KY. Mold hyphae penetrate porous surfaces including duct liner material and cannot be entirely removed by physical cleaning alone in Tompkinsville. Residual spores on cleaned surfaces can re-establish the mold colony if the moisture conditions that produced the original growth remain in Tompkinsville, KY. Antimicrobial treatment applied after thorough physical removal addresses the residual contamination and creates surface conditions that inhibit re-establishment in Tompkinsville.

What Causes Mold in Ducts

What Causes Mold to Grow in Air Ducts in Tompkinsville, KY

Condensation in the Duct System in Tompkinsville

Forms on duct surfaces when the surface temperature drops below the dew point of surrounding air in Tompkinsville, KY. Most common on supply ducts carrying cold conditioned air in summer passing through warm, humid unconditioned spaces in Tompkinsville. Correct duct insulation in unconditioned spaces prevents condensation by maintaining duct surface temperature above the dew point in Tompkinsville, KY.

High Indoor Humidity Levels in Tompkinsville, KY

Indoor relative humidity consistently above 60 percent provides the moisture conditions that support mold growth throughout the home, including on duct surfaces in Tompkinsville. Controlling indoor humidity to below 50 to 60 percent is the foundational measure for preventing mold growth throughout the home in Tompkinsville, KY.

Water Intrusion Near Duct Runs in Tompkinsville

Flooding, pipe leaks, and roof leaks affecting areas near duct runs can introduce moisture to the duct system directly in Tompkinsville, KY. Mold can establish on wetted duct surfaces within 24 to 48 hours under favorable temperature conditions in Tompkinsville. Duct systems that have been submerged or significantly wetted should be assessed for mold growth in the weeks following the moisture event in Tompkinsville, KY.

Dirty Evaporator Coil Producing Excess Moisture in Tompkinsville, KY

A dirty evaporator coil operates less efficiently and can produce excess condensation that does not drain correctly in Tompkinsville. Standing water in the air handler drain pan is a direct mold growth site that seeds contamination into the duct system with every HVAC cycle in Tompkinsville, KY.

Inadequate Insulation on Duct Runs in Tompkinsville

Duct runs in attics, crawl spaces, and garages with inadequate insulation are subject to significant surface temperature variation in Tompkinsville, KY. Cold conditioned air chills the duct surface below the dew point of surrounding air, producing condensation on the exterior and sometimes interior of the duct in Tompkinsville.
